谷歌海量数据存储系统Bigtable:分布式结构化数据的基石

需积分: 44 0 下载量 193 浏览量 更新于2024-07-27 收藏 2.41MB PDF 举报
"谷歌文章汇总主要关注的是Google的相关技术论文,特别是关于大数据存储和管理系统的研究。本文提到的核心是Bigtable,一个由Google开发的分布式结构化数据存储系统,旨在处理海量数据,支持PB级别的数据存储和在数千台普通服务器上的扩展部署。Bigtable的成功在于其灵活性、高性能和高可用性,适用于Google众多产品,如Web索引、Google Earth、Google Finance等,这些产品有着不同的数据需求,从大规模批处理到实时数据服务。 Bigtable的设计和实现非常注重适应性和可扩展性,能够在各种规模的集群环境中运行,从小型集群到包含上千台服务器、几百TB数据的大型集群。它的数据模型允许用户动态控制数据的分布和格式,这与传统的关系型数据库不同,Bigtable不支持完整的SQL查询,而是提供了一个不同于并行数据库和内存数据库的接口。 论文详细介绍了Bigtable的设计过程,包括如何通过可靠的机制来处理大量数据,以及如何在满足高性能的同时保证系统的稳定运行。此外,文章还提到了Bigtable已经在Google的多个项目中得到了广泛应用,证明了其在实际业务场景中的实用价值和效率。 整体而言,这个资源对于了解Google在大数据存储领域的技术创新和实践具有很高的价值,对于IT专业人士和研究者来说,深入理解Bigtable的设计理念和技术细节有助于他们在分布式系统设计和优化方面取得启示。"